    Echo cs 60 new find exhaust strange......

    I really don't think its a 1970 model. Look for a Kioritz tag where the sn is. The '70 models didn't say Kioritz. The muffler is on upside down. It should point to the chain side...Bob

    Echo ________ = John Deere ________?

    I have some memory of them...Bob JD 25EV Echo CS-290 JD 28 Echo CS-315 JD 30 Echo CS-302 pre S JD 44V Echo CS-440EVL JD 50V Echo CS-452VL JD 55V Echo CS-500 JD 60V Echo CS-602 JD 70V Echo CS-702 JD 80V Echo CS-750 Found it Post #6 http://www.arboristsite.com/chainsaw/198539.htm

    Echo model ID help.

    Yup a CS-302. One of the first light saws from the early 70's. Made until about '79 when the CS-302S took its place. Good saw i have a few of them in Kioritz, Craftsman and JD versions.
